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
583938965 290 82015150
772929400 6317832033 675
772929400 6317832033 675
7502883892 9679 45857
All about undefined
Interested in learning more?
772929400 6317832033 675
7502883892 9679 45857
See more
94345 45980308
6903 9230500578 79154
See more
885951 331614 363
088112 67 3593 699
See more